Atomoxetine Drug Class: A Comprehensive Overview
Introduction to Atomoxetine: Nonstimulant ADHD Treatment
Atomoxetine, marketed under the brand name Strattera, is a selective norepinephrine reuptake inhibitor (NRI) used primarily for the treatment of attention-deficit/hyperactivity disorder (ADHD) in children, adolescents, and adults Kratochvil2003Fu2022Corman2004. Unlike traditional stimulant medications for ADHD, such as methylphenidate, atomoxetine is a nonstimulant, making it a unique option for patients who may not respond well to or cannot tolerate stimulant medications Kratochvil2002Simpson2004Corman2004.
Mechanism of Action: Selective Norepinephrine Reuptake Inhibition
Atomoxetine works by selectively inhibiting the presynaptic norepinephrine transporter, which increases the levels of norepinephrine in the brain. This action helps improve attention and reduce hyperactive and impulsive behaviors associated with ADHD Spencer2002Fu2022Weintraub2010. Additionally, atomoxetine has minimal affinity for other neurotransmitter transporters or receptors, which contributes to its specific action profile Spencer2002Fu2022.
Clinical Efficacy: Comparable to Stimulants
Multiple studies have demonstrated the efficacy of atomoxetine in treating ADHD symptoms. Clinical trials have shown that atomoxetine significantly reduces ADHD symptoms as measured by various rating scales, such as the ADHD-IV Rating Scale and the Conners Adult ADHD Rating Scale (CAARS) Kratochvil2002Kratochvil2003Spencer2002. In head-to-head comparisons, atomoxetine has been found to have therapeutic effects comparable to those of methylphenidate, a commonly used stimulant .
Safety and Tolerability: A Well-Tolerated Option
Atomoxetine is generally well tolerated, with a safety profile that has been extensively studied over the years. Common side effects include dry mouth, insomnia, nausea, decreased appetite, and dizziness, but these are typically mild to moderate and transient Reed2015Simpson2004Corman2004. Long-term safety data indicate that serious adverse events, such as suicidality, aggression, and liver injury, are uncommon or rare . Additionally, atomoxetine does not have the abuse potential associated with stimulant medications, making it a safer option for long-term use Fu2022Simpson2004.
Dosage and Administration: Flexible Dosing Regimen
Atomoxetine can be administered either as a single daily dose or split into two evenly divided doses. The recommended dosage is weight-based, with adjustments made to achieve optimal therapeutic effects while minimizing side effects Fu2022Corman2004. For children and adolescents weighing less than 70 kg, the target dosage is 1.2 mg/kg/day, while for those weighing more than 70 kg and adults, the target dosage is 80 mg/day .
